Pro-Graad Surface Conditioning Wheels Selection Guide

For precision deburring, finishing, blending, cleaning, and more. Find the perfect wheel for your application in three easy steps.

Getting Started: Wheel Selection in 3 Easy Steps

1

Select Your Equipment Type

Convolute Wheels: Typically larger wheels wrapped around a core. Best for stationary equipment like bench grinders or pedestal buffers.

Unitized Wheels: Compressed layers of abrasive material. Generally smaller and used on portable power tools like die grinders.

2

Define Your Application

Deburring & Radiusing: If you are removing burrs or rounding sharp edges, select a Deburring Wheel.

Aesthetic Finishing: If you are creating a specific surface pattern or satin finish, select a Finishing Wheel.

Dual Requirement: If your part requires both, always start with a deburring wheel first, then follow up with a finishing wheel.

3

Understand the Product Code

Use this key to read Pro-Graad wheel descriptions:

Density: Numbers 2–11. Higher = harder, more durable

Mineral: S = Silicon Carbide (Sharp/Fine), A = Aluminum Oxide (Tough)

Grade: VFN = Very Fine, FIN = Fine, MED = Medium, CRS = Coarse

Size: Diameter x Width x Core Diameter

Convolute Wheels

Stationary Equipment Solutions. Larger wheels wrapped around a core for bench grinders, pedestal buffers, and high-production environments.

Deburring Wheels

For removing burrs, rounding sharp edges, and precision edge radiusing.

Product Name Density Grade Characteristics & Best Uses
Pro-Graad Cut & Polish 5, 7 MED, CRS

High-cut rate for tough blending and finishing applications.

Best for: Aggressive blending and heavy-duty deburring

Pro-Graad EXL 8, 9, 10, 11 FIN, MED, CRS

High performance; 10 & 11 are used for maximum edge retention.

Best for: General deburring with excellent edge retention

Pro-Graad EX2 8, 9 FIN, MED

Versatile & Conformable: Hard, dense consistency for fast deburring and polishing. Ideal for stamped or laser-cut parts.

Best for: Fast deburring on stamped and laser-cut parts

Pro-Graad EX3 8, 9 FIN, MED

Performance Leader: Highest edge retention and durability in its line. Optimized for sharp edges and metal burrs.

Best for: Sharp edges and metal burrs with smooth operation

Pro-Graad EXL PRO 9, 10 FIN, MED

Next Generation: Optimized for significantly higher durability and faster cut rates in heavy deburring.

Best for: Heavy deburring with maximum durability

Pro-Graad EXT 8, 9, 10, 11 FIN, MED

Titanium Specialist: Excels in high-pressure applications. Ideal for automated deburring and edge radiusing.

Best for: Titanium and hard alloys with automated systems

Pro-Graad Series 1000 RF Long Life 6, 8, 9 MED, FIN

High-Production Specialty: Smear-resistant and high-durability; ideal for precision deburring and high-production polishing.

Best for: High-production environments with precision requirements

Pro-Graad Series 4000 RF Long Life 8, 9 MED, FIN

Next Generation RF: Harder density and increased durability compared to Series 1000.

Best for: Extended life in high-production deburring

Understanding Product Codes

DDensity

Numbers 2–11. Higher numbers indicate harder, more durable wheels with better edge retention.

Example: Density 8 = Hard, durable wheel suitable for precision work

MMineral

The abrasive material composition of the wheel.

S = Silicon Carbide (Sharp, Fine, Fast-cutting)

A = Aluminum Oxide (Tough, Durable, Long-lasting)

GGrade

The fineness of the abrasive particles.

VFN = Very Fine (Smooth, precise finishes)

FIN = Fine (Balanced performance)

MED = Medium (Versatile cutting)

CRS = Coarse (Aggressive cutting)

SSize

The physical dimensions of the wheel.

Format: Diameter x Width x Core Diameter

Example: 8" x 1" x 3" wheel

Recommendations by Material

Aluminum

Pro-Graad Multi-Finish for bright, uniform appearance

Metal Finishing for brushed textures

Produces clean, bright finishes without discoloration

Stainless Steel

Pro-Graad SST for specialized stainless steel finishing

Metal Finishing for premium satin finishes

Multi-Finish for uniform #3 or #4 brushed finishes

Cut & Polish Unitized for aggressive blending

Achieve specific mill/satin finishes (#3 or #4) with excellent consistency

Steel (Carbon/Mild)

Pro-Graad EXL or EXL PRO for general deburring

Cut & Polish (Convolute or Unitized) for aggressive blending

Heavy oxidation or scale removal

Excellent for removing burrs and heavy oxidation

Titanium

Pro-Graad EXT for best-in-class performance

EXL, EXL PRO for finishing and precision deburring

SST for specialized titanium finishing

Specialized wheels designed for high-pressure titanium applications
